Composite drier for aqueous air drying type coating
A composite drier and air-drying technology, which is applied in the direction of drier, chemical instruments and methods, etc., can solve the problems of reduced gloss, easy defects on the surface of the paint film, and decreased stability of the dispersion system, so as to improve optical quality. properties, ideal appearance, maintenance and improvement of effectiveness and long-lasting effects

Embodiment 1
[0032] 22.2 g of cobalt isooctanoate (13.5% by weight of metal content), 16.5 g of zirconium isooctanoate (24.3% by weight of metal content), 20 g of manganese isooctanoate (10 wt. # Add 5g of gasoline into the adjustable-speed high-speed stirring tank, pass nitrogen gas at room temperature, start the stirrer, and gradually increase the speed from low to high to 2000-3000r / min, and mix well. Weigh 27.3g of deionized water, add deionized water dropwise at a certain rate, the viscosity of the system increases with the increase of deionized water, and the viscosity decreases rapidly after reaching the phase inversion point, and then add the remaining deionized water Stir the tank, and reduce the rotation speed to 400-1000r / min to obtain the purple composite drier emulsion I, the solid content of which is 56.4% by weight.
Embodiment 2
[0034] 22.2 g of cobalt isooctanoate (13.5% by weight of metal content), 20.6 g of zirconium isooctanoate (24.3% by weight of metal content), 21.3 g of barium naphthenate (14.1% by weight of metal content), 10 g of reactive non-migratory surfactant and 200 # Add 5g of gasoline into the adjustable-speed high-speed stirring tank, pass nitrogen gas at room temperature, start the stirrer, and gradually increase the speed from low to high to 2000-3000r / min, and mix well. Weigh 21.7g of deionized water, add deionized water dropwise at a certain rate, the viscosity of the system increases with the increase of deionized water, and the viscosity decreases rapidly after reaching the phase inversion point, and then add the remaining deionized water Stir the tank, and reduce the rotation speed to 400-1000r / min to obtain the purple composite drier emulsion II with a solid content of 55.8% by weight.
Embodiment 3
[0036] Cobalt isooctanoate (13.5% by weight of metal content) 37g, zirconium isooctanoate (24.3% by weight of metal content) 31g, lithium naphthenate (10% by weight of metal content) 2g, reactive non-migrating surfactant 10g and 200 # Add 5g of gasoline into the adjustable-speed high-speed stirring tank, pass nitrogen gas at room temperature, start the stirrer, and gradually increase the speed from low to high to 2000-3000r / min, and mix well. Weigh 15g of deionized water, add deionized water dropwise at a certain rate, the viscosity of the system increases with the increase of the amount of deionized water, and the viscosity decreases rapidly after reaching the phase inversion point, and then add the remaining deionized water to stir kettle, and reduce the rotation speed to 400-1000r / min to obtain purple composite drier emulsion III with a solid content of 72.0% by weight.
